Birmingham Midshires 5.40% soon to be 5.10%

Options
Tomorrow (Thursday) Birmingham Midshires are closing their Internet Easy Access a/c to new applicants.
To attain the 5.40% gross rate, apply quickly! (includes 1st year bonus).

This Friday, they launch Issue 2 of the a/c, @ just 5.10% (including 1st year bonus of 0.20%).

The a/c seems attractive for lump sum savings. It's probably less suitable for frequent withdrawals or deposits.

Terms + Conditions don't mention it but the following uncompetitive money-movement facts were revealed by Birmingham Midshires text presented during test transfers to & from the linked bank a/c :

"when you send money [pre-3pm] to your linked account, it will take up to 4 bank working days to arrive."

"when you request money from your linked account, we will send the request on the day you ask for it. The money will then take up to 4 bank working days to reach your Internet Easy Access account from your bank."
